The Botnet That Took Over Twitter in 2016

Our website grew very fast and our following got extremely large due to some technical innovations I came up with along with my partner. We learned a lot on the marketing side of things because we ran every aspect of our business together, without outsourcing a single process or project. Eventually, we had over 5,000 people sharing our articles automatically on several different platforms through public automation tools we made available to our users.

Every website generally has a CTA or “Call to Action”, ours was focused on building a networking army. In other words, our so-called “botnet” was actually a huge network of real people who wanted to share our news and signed up to do so.

How Did The Real Strategy End?

We used IFTTT for the bulk of our public automation, which suddenly became a paid feature costing over $2,000 per month. IFTTT deactivated our public recipes for the free service we used, removing our ability to reach millions. At the same time they made a deal with the New York Times, allowing them to publish their new recipes into their public library! Laughably, the NYT’s still doesn’t even have half of the user base signed up to share their content as we had, and its been 4 years! A couple weeks after the IFTTT shutdown a NYT reporter came at me with a lawsuit for using one of his images in an article on a riot. I paid him off and removed the image, which was clearly fair-use, and newsworthy, but nevertheless, I didn’t have the money to fight back. I was clearly being targeted by a million dollar corporation and had zero interest in fighting them.

After the followers of our site began to dwindle, the money we made followed, which was not much to begin with. So, the decision was made to abandon ship and move forward.
